Mars has a thin atmosphere composed mainly of what gas?
Answer / Anand Swaroop Srivastava
Mars' thin atmosphere, or Martian atmosphere, is primarily composed of carbon dioxide (CO2), with trace amounts of nitrogen (N2) and argon (Ar).
